Faith and bravery, those were the first words that came to my mind when I read the bible verse and Stott's explanation for today.
Thinking about the persecutions that the early Christians had to go through to spread the word of Christ, and how they endured and triumphed so that we may know of Christ's life and the sacrifice he made for us two thousand years later is amazing to me.
As Stott says what we pass off as Christianity today is not the way that the early Christians practiced their religion and I think that's one thing that we can take away from today's verse. The love and passion that the early Christians had for Christ.
